You 17? Limit all personal information. It gets to be more complicated the more you post. Gender and especially age and location info are not needed. Even if you do -all- this, as pointed out before, all it takes is one "friend" to hand out everything they know about you to everyone.
Many have not thought this through and some younger posters have lived to regret -what- they posted. DOD, FBI, ATF, and LEO background checks should be your primary concern, it could cost you a federal job or a $ecurity clearance.
Secondly the possibility of civilian employers finding what you posted.
Federal Intel agencies can ID you to your posts if they want to go to the trouble. Be more concerned as the what you post than to "hiding" your identity.
